Recognizing the Corrosion of the Brake System




Understanding what causes brake system corrosion is essential before diving into prevention strategies. brake service Pompano Beach, FL. When metal brake system parts like brake calipers, rotors, and brake lines are exposed to moisture, salt, or other environmental factors, corrosion takes place. The integrity of the braking system is compromised over time as a result of this exposure, which causes rust and corrosion.

Preventative Actions




  1. Regular Inspections: The first line of defense against corrosion is routine inspections of your car's brake system. Check the brake parts for any indications of corrosion or rust, such as pitted or discolored surfaces. Early detection of corrosion can stop it from getting worse.
  2. Regularly wash your car: This helps get rid of salt, dirt, and other corrosive materials that can build up on the brake parts of the car, including the undercarriage. During the winter, when roads are frequently treated with salt, regular washing is especially crucial.
  3. Avoid Long-term Moisture Exposure: Parking your car in a garage or other covered space can help keep moisture from building up on the brake system. Consider using waterproof covers for your car during rainy or snowy seasons if a garage is not available.
  4. Brake fluid upkeep: The brake system's brake fluid is essential for preventing corrosion. Make sure to check the recommended intervals for changing your brake fluid. Old or tainted brake fluid can hasten deterioration.
  5. Rust-resistant Coatings: A second layer of protection can be added by coating vulnerable brake parts with rust-resistant coatings. These coatings build a barrier that keeps salt and moisture away from the metal's surface.
  6. Use Corrosion-resistant Parts: When replacing brake parts, think about using materials that are resistant to corrosion, like stainless steel or ceramic brake pads. These substances are less prone to corrosion and rust.
  7. Proper Lubrication: Follow the manufacturer's advice and lubricate the brake parts. The likelihood of corrosion is decreased by lubrication, which helps prevent wear and friction.
  8. Avoid Harsh Chemicals: Avoid using harsh chemicals that could harm the brake system when cleaning your car. Stick to mild, car-specific cleaning supplies.
  9. Keep Drains Clear: Make sure that there is no debris in the drainage channels around the brake components. Drains that are clogged can cause water to build up, raising the risk of corrosion.

Long-term upkeep

  1. Consider having an annual rust inspection performed by a qualified mechanic, especially if you reside in an area with long winters or frequent salt exposure.
  2. Rust Treatment: Take immediate action to treat corrosion if it is found during inspections. Cleaning, sanding, and covering the affected areas with sealants or rust inhibitors are some examples of this.
  3. Brake System Overhaul: To replace heavily corroded parts over time, a thorough brake system overhaul may be required. This requires a sizable financial commitment, so it should only be carried out by an experienced mechanic.
